Output aafa15635968016530cac5e505fcbcf72cedaf27de20e11f820a1dc168c44e4b:8

value
646262
script pubkey
OP_0 OP_PUSHBYTES_32 229a66d85a0cd7f6e101e4186b5cf554328b126657225d8e53355ff21ab7172b
address
bc1qy2dxdkz6pntldcgpusvxkh842segkynx2u39mrjnx40lyx4hzu4skw2m8v
transaction
aafa15635968016530cac5e505fcbcf72cedaf27de20e11f820a1dc168c44e4b
spent
true